Understand Vietnam's F&B scene and the country’s romanticism with cocktail bars, cafes and ‘cosy spaces’ through an exploration of District 1's F&B alleys. This tour experience will allow you to:
- Learn the history of the cafe apartment, a multi-storey building now home to cocktail bars, cafes and even restaurants housed inside apartments as ‘home businesses’.
- Stop by cocktail apartments and F&B businesses built on the 2nd and 3rd floor of street front buildings.
- Touch on how modern Vietnamese cuisine, international accolades like the MICHELIN Guide are influencing Vietnam's F&B industry as we cross the famous Banh Mi Nhu Lan.
- Find out how modern F&B concepts balance cultural preservation with contemporary preferences and affect trends in architectural preservation and adaptive reuse in Saigon.
- Learn how evolving regulations impact property usage and development.
- View how F&B venues anchor commercial districts by creating social hubs and contributing to neighbourhood vitality and economic growth.
- Share insights on how trends like eco-conscious practices, social responsibility and fire safety regulations are shaping business models and in turn, the layout and functionality of these spaces.

Take this opportunity to visit Thu Thiem and learn how developments there have evolved over the years, transforming the Ho Chi Minh City landscape. Thu Thiem is a dynamic new urban area located on the Thu Thiem Peninsula. Envisioned as the city’s future financial and cultural hub, this 6.57 km² redevelopment project is strategically positioned across the Saigon River from the historic District 1, making it a prime location for both business and residential development.
The group will have an opportunity to tour:
- Sala City, a premier eco-urban area that redefines modern living in Ho Chi Minh City. Nestled in the heart of District 2, it spans an impressive 257 hectares. This thoughtfully designed community harmonises nature with urban convenience, creating a vibrant environment for residents and visitors alike.
- The Metropole Thu Thiem stands as a premier mixed-use development that redefines luxury living and modern urban lifestyle in Ho Chi Minh City. Inspired by world-class metropolitan areas, this vibrant community combines residential, commercial, and recreational spaces to create a unique urban experience.
- Empire City spans 14.6 hectares along the picturesque Saigon River. This premier mixed-use development features approximately 3,000 luxury apartments, an iconic 88-storey tower, and a variety of retail and office spaces. With world-class amenities, including lush green parks, swimming pools, and fitness centers, Empire City offers a harmonious blend of modern living and urban convenience.

Led by Skidmore, Owings and Merrill (SOM), the master planners behind this area, this tour will visit Saigon South, one of Vietnam’s most successful planned communities. The Saigon South Master Plan is a comprehensive design to help Ho Chi Minh City accommodate the physical expansion generated by economic growth while safeguarding its significant cultural and natural assets. The 2,630-hectare master plan creates a modern, international community with a series of compact, walkable neighborhoods and an extensive network of scenic waterways. It presents the overall vision, concept, and development framework to allow the city to function as a self-contained community, and also offers flexible planning principles to address a range of potential development scenarios in this flourishing Vietnamese city.
Developed by the Phu My Hung Development Corporation, Phu My Hung is part of the Saigon South urban project and was transformed from marshland into a modern urban centre since its inception in the early 1990s. It has been recognised as a "model urban area" by the Ministry of Construction and the People's Committee of Ho Chi Minh City due to its successful urban planning and development. The area includes residential, commercial, and recreational spaces, making it a multifunctional urban environment that caters to both local and expatriate communities.
